Observation of a Pinning Mode in a Wigner Solid with v = 1/3 Fractional Quantum Hall Excitations
Abstract
We report the observation of a resonance in the microwave spectra of the real diagonal conductivities of a two-dimensional electron system within a range of similar to +/- 0.015 from filling factor v = 1/3. The resonance is remarkably similar to resonances previously observed near integer v, and is interpreted as the collective pinning mode of a disorder-pinned Wigner solid phase of e/3-charged carriers.
